once on a survival course in Montana in the late summer they gave us gallon milk jugs, with a bit cut out, but the handle left so you could hang it off your belt with a carabiner. then they told us to catch all the grasshoppers we could all day and snap the big back legs off and let them go. we were all like wtf? but it wasn't a situation where questions were encouraged, so....


late in the day we all have half full to full jugs of legs...all kinds of twitchy nastiness.:whoo: and then the old boy in charge pulls out a big kettle to go over the fire pit he makes us build. and the water and Crab Boil. now if you are from the southern USA you know Crab Boil....it's a kinda greasy block of spices or a bag of powdered same...you put it in the water and boil your chosen crustacean in it and it auto spices it. good stuff, but i wasn't real thrilled with what i thought i saw comin up.

sure enough, he asked if anyone had ever cleaned shrimp. so i said yes and two other guys, and we got to slip the tiny bit of meat in each grasshopper leg out into the pot while training every other ham handed fool to (apparently) drop dinner in the dirt....:rolleyes:

now those of you who haven't seen late summer Montana grasshoppers need to know, these aren't the little things you see in town. i'm a big guy, and these things were at least the thickness of my thumb and longer by 50%.

with some freeze dried veggies and some wild garlic and greens he made some of the other poor victims dig up, it made a damn nice jambalaya.

tasted just like shrimp.:stoned::crazy2::rockon:

maggots, interestingly enough, are cleaner than most stuff you can eat. and any flesh they are feeding off of directly will not be spoiled either; the are so good at creating a clean environment that at last resort, one may apply maggots to a gangrenous wound. they will eat all of the necrotic tissue, leaving only the clean and healthy tissue.

horrible, but far better than dying of blood poisoning somewhere unpronounceable while you try to steal a boat to get the fuck out o' this thirdworld shithole. :evil:
